On Tue, Nov 29, 2005 at 07:30:35PM +0100, Marcus Comstedt wrote: > > Gunther Nikl <gni@xxxxxxxx> writes: > > > > Following up myself: Now it looks like a GCC 3.4.x only compiler > > bug :-/ All other tested versions (2.95.x, 3.3.x, 4.0 and 4.1) > > prepend an underscore and then of course there is no problem. > > Looks like I searched at the wrong place for a bug :-( > > Yeah. Prepending an _ to the variable name seems like a correct fix. > At least until someone adds a register with a name starting with _ to > the assembler. :-) Hopefully that will never happen ;-) FYI, our problem is a known bug, its http://gcc.gnu.org/PR14516. Unfortunately GCC authorities decided *not* to fix this problem for the 3.4 series :-/ Gunther -- Linux is only free if your time has no value - Jamie Zawinski ______________________________________________________________________________ Amiga Development tools ML - //www.freelists.org/list/adtools Homepage...................: http://www.sourceforge.net/projects/adtools Listserver help............: mailto:adtools-request@xxxxxxxxxxxxx?Subject=HELP